Troubleshooting
Problem
Solution
Thermostat works but no
heat from the system.
1. Check wiring connections.
2. If GFCI is tripped, reset thermostat
with on/off switch.
3. Check resistances on floor heating
system. See manual for system.
No display
1. Check wiring connections.
2. Check circuit breaker or other
protection “upstream” of
thermostat.
GFCI is tripped
1. Check wiring connections.
2. Reset thermostat by switching
on/off.
3. Check resistances on floor heating
system. See manual for system.
Heating occurs at the wrong
times
1. Check that the current time and
schedule times are properly set to
AM or PM.
2. On uninsulated concrete
SmartStart may start heating very
early. You may turn this feature off
if not desired.
Err1:Wrong floor sensor
Floor sensor not correct type or
out of range. Check floor sensor
resistance.
Err2:Floor sensor shorted
Floor sensor short-circuited. Turn off
power at breaker. Make sure wires
are not crossed at the terminals.
Or replace sensor. Or Reset Factory
Defaults.
Err3:Floor sensor missing
Floor sensor not attached and
thermostat is in floor sense mode.
Turn off power at breaker and attach
sensor. Or Reset Factory Defaults.
Err4/Err5:Internal sensor
fail
Internal air sensor is faulty. Replace
thermostat or operate in floor sense
mode.
Err6:Internal temp limit
Internal temperature overlimit. Make
sure sunlight is not directed at the
thermostat or other heat sources in
proximity. Make sure load does not
exceed 15 amps. Otherwise, turn
off power at breaker and contact
factory.
Err7:End-of-life
“End-of-life” indication. GFCI will no
longer function correctly or safely.
Reset the circuit breaker or replace
thermostat.
Specifications
Power Supply
120/240 VAC, 50/60 Hz
Maximum Load
15 amps, resistive
Maximum Power
1800 watts at 120 VAC
3600 watts at 240 VAC
GFCI
Class A (5 milliamp trip nominal)
Display Range
32°F to 99°F (0°C to 37°C)
Setting Range
40°F to 99°F (4°C to 37°C)
Accuracy
± 0.9°F (0.5°C)
Environment
Indoor dry location only
Storage Temperature 0°F to 120°F (-17°C to 49°C)
Floor Sensor
Thermistor, 10k NTC type, double-insulated
Memory
Programming retained indefinitely
Current time/day will need reset if power is lost more than 30 minutes.
ETL Listing
Control No. 3037530
Conforms to UL 873, UL 943, CSA C22.2 No. 24, CSA/CAN C22.2 No. 144
Limited Warranty
Infloor warrants this control (the product) to be free from defect in material
and workmanship for a period of (3) years from the date of original purchase
from authorized dealers. During this period, Infloor will replace the product or
refund the original cost of the product at Infloor’s option, without charge, if
the product is proven defective in normal use. Please return the control to your
distributor to begin the warranty process.
This limited warranty does not cover shipping costs. Nor does it cover a product
subjected to misuse or accidental damage. This warranty does not cover the cost
of installation, diagnosis, removal or reinstallation, or any material costs or loss
of use.
